Here is what we know regarding the requirements to open a dispensary in Connecticut. Adult Use Cannabis License Fees Non-Social Equity Fees. Cultivator – Lottery $1000, Provisional $25000, License $75000. Micro-cultivator – Lottery $250, Provisional $500, License $1000

WebIn Connecticut, the fee for medical marijuana certification cards is $100 for new and renewing patients. The cost for caregivers is $25. Connecticut’s medical marijuana card fees are among the lowest across the country.
